Nortel Networks eyes approval of claim settlement with Deka Immobilien

By Lisa Kerner

Charlotte, N.C., April 18 - Nortel Networks Inc. asked the court to approve a stipulation with Deka Immobilien Investment GmbH, according to a Monday filing with the U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the District of Delaware.

A hearing is scheduled for May 24.

Deka filed a general unsecured claim for about $2.44 million in September 2009 for unpaid rent related to an office lease agreement with Nortel for the property at 2325 Dulles Corner Blvd., Herndon, Va.

In addition, Deka filed an administrative claim for $686.

The stipulation will give Deka an allowed general claim of $2.4 million and an administrative claim of $817.

Nortel, a Brampton, Ont.-based manufacturer and supplier of telecommunications networking equipment, filed for bankruptcy on Jan. 14, 2009. Its Chapter 11 case number is 09-10138.
